Description

From Iceland to the Orient - could we get further apart?

This blend of seed will produce a glorious display of flower - from the delicate lemon yellow flowers of the Icelandic Poppy that stands proudly above the rosette of hairy pale green foliage - to the beautiful ruffled flowers of the Oriental Poppy, in shades of salmon, orange, scarlet, white, pink, crimson and mahogany.

Recommended by the RHS to be an excellent attractant and nectar source for bees and other beneficial insects.

  • Hardy Biennial / Hardy Herbaceous Perennial.
  • Excellent for Cut Flowers.
  • Flower June - September.
  • Sow May to June in well prepared seed bed outside.
  • Sow thinly in " (0.5 cm) drills 10" (25 cm) apart.
  • As the seedlings grow thin out if they become crowded.
  • Transplant to their final growing positions when they are large enough to handle, planting 12" (30 cm) apart.
